In this powerful episode of Bailey & Buck Unplugged, the hosts sit down with Joanna Alba — founder of Alba Legacy, Co-Author of InHerPurpose , and Co-Founder of @RepurposeLegacy — a renowned custom fashion designer known for creating made-to-measure pieces for high-profile clients in sports and entertainment. But this conversation goes far beyond style.Joanna shares her deeply personal journey through childhood trauma, domestic violence, family separation, substance use, and suicidal thoughts, and how creativity became her lifeline. From thrifting and redesigning clothes as a kid to building a career in formalwear and launching her own brand, she explains how purpose-driven entrepreneurship helped her reclaim her voice and her future.The conversation explores forgiveness, rebuilding family relationships, and the role of faith, discipline, and service in healing. Joanna also opens up about losing a loved one to suicide, navigating grief, and why compassion matters in mental health conversations. Plus, she shares practical ways she resets today, including embracing solitude, prioritizing recovery, and protecting her peace.If you or someone you love is struggling, you’re not alone.
